**Ticket: Websocket reconnects flapping — drifted config**

Hey — the Marrowlane chat widget keeps dropping and reconnecting every ~30s on prod. Turns out someone bumped the heartbeat interval on one node but not the others, so the load balancer thinks half the sockets are dead. Classic drift. Here's what the affected node is currently running.

service settings:
PRAIX_LOG_LEVEL=error
PRAIX_METRICS_HOST=metrics.praix.qorvelcorp.corp
PRAIX_POOL_SIZE=16

Subject: Tracing cut-over complete

Hi all — we finished migrating Lanternmesh services to span-propagated request tracing last night. Headers are now signed at the gateway, trace IDs no longer leak into client-facing error bodies, and sampling decisions happen upstream only. For your audit, the post-cut-over settings now active in production are as follows.

deployment values, taweg-bajop:
[fenvan]
port = 5672
team = holmir
host = fenvan.orvexio.example
region = lower-1
access_code = ac_b98bc6
timeout_ms = 1500

Handover — new Aldermoor depot uniforms. Full order arrived from Brackley Workwear: 42 jackets, 60 shirts, assorted trousers. Sizes checked against the roster, two shirts short, reorder placed. Boxes stacked by bay door two, labelled by size. Depot wants them before Monday's start. Book the run for Friday. Driver must not leave them at the gatehouse. Courier hand-over instruction is below.

handover note for yagef-bagep: the drudor pelius courier leaves the kasdor zorvan norir ledger at gate 8016 under passcode 755406